AI does not have to break a rule to defeat the protection it was designed to provide. A Synthetic Outlaw is an AI system that produces a prohibited or socially destructive outcome while remaining formally compliant, or operating beyond the effective reach of the laws and institutions meant to constrain it. It does not need intent or malice of its own: it can defeat the protection a rule was designed to provide even as it remains formally compliant with that same rule. The Synthetic Outlaw develops the legal, architectural, and institutional framework required to close that gap.

Jonathan Gropper, JD

Jonathan Gropper is an American Sovereign AI Architect, author, and technology founder whose work sits at the intersection of AI governance, institutional design, and deployed civic technology. He is the author of The Synthetic Outlaw (forthcoming 2026), a Fulbright Specialist designated by the U.S. Department of State, and the founder of TrueHOA, a blockchain-anchored verified election platform governing real communities.
